In this video, CAPTURE 3D’s Kyle and Emily will be discussing updates to the ZEISS Quality Suite Ecosystem, which is a one-stop shop for all of your industrial quality needs. This ecosystem includes GOM Software, a community- forum, trainings and e-learnings, the Tech Guide and sample data. Plus, the ZEISS Reverse Engineering software is now part of this suite, along with added functionality for communication between GOM Software, PiWeb, and Calypso.
